在移动互联网持续深化的当下,小程序软件开发正成为企业实现数字化转型的重要抓手。相较于传统App,小程序以轻量化、即用即走的特性,显著降低了用户使用门槛,也为企业提供了低成本触达海量用户的高效路径。尤其在深圳这座科技创新高地,众多中小企业依托本地成熟的产业链与技术生态,将小程序作为业务增长的新引擎。无论是零售电商的线上引流,还是本地生活服务的场景化运营,小程序都展现出强大的适配能力。这种趋势背后,不仅是技术演进的必然,更是企业在竞争中寻求差异化突破的真实需求。
对于大多数初创团队或中小型企业而言,快速上线、降低开发成本是首要考量。然而,市面上大量依赖第三方平台生成的“模板化”小程序,往往存在功能冗余、定制性差、数据归属模糊等问题。一旦遇到特定业务逻辑需求,如复杂的订单处理流程、多端同步的会员体系,这些现成工具便显得力不从心。更关键的是,模板化开发通常将源码封装在封闭系统内,开发者无法深入优化性能或进行安全加固,埋下潜在风险。因此,真正具备长期竞争力的小程序软件开发,必须回归到“源码级”的可控与可维护性。
所谓源码开发,指的是开发者从零开始构建项目结构,自主编写核心代码,而非依赖可视化拖拽或自动化生成工具。这一模式虽然前期投入更高,但带来的价值远超短期成本。它允许团队根据实际业务需求灵活调整架构,精准控制每一个功能模块的行为,同时为后续迭代预留充足空间。例如,在一个社区团购类小程序中,若采用源码开发,可针对库存更新频率高、订单并发量大的特点,自定义数据缓存策略与异步处理机制,避免因框架限制导致的卡顿或崩溃。

在真实项目实践中,我们观察到,多数团队在进入开发阶段后仍沿用旧有思维,未能有效利用现代前端工程化手段。这直接导致了加载速度慢、兼容性差、维护困难等常见问题。为此,我们提出一套基于模块化架构的源码开发流程,并引入微前端思想对业务逻辑进行解耦。通过将首页、商品详情、个人中心等独立模块分别打包,不仅提升了代码复用率,也使得团队成员可以并行开发而互不干扰。更重要的是,当某个模块需要更新时,仅需重新编译该部分,无需整体发布,极大缩短了迭代周期。
性能优化始终是小程序软件开发中的核心议题。首屏加载时间过长会直接导致用户流失,据行业数据显示,每延迟1秒,跳出率上升约10%。针对这一痛点,我们建议采取分包加载策略——将非首屏内容拆分为独立分包,按需加载。结合代码压缩、图片懒加载以及资源预加载等技术,实测可使首屏加载时间缩短40%以上。此外,真机调试应贯穿整个开发周期,而非仅在发布前进行。通过真实设备模拟用户行为,及时发现并修复兼容性问题,确保在不同机型、系统版本下的稳定表现。
安全性同样不容忽视。源码开发赋予开发者对数据传输、接口调用、权限管理的完全掌控权。例如,可在登录流程中嵌入双向认证机制,防止账号被盗;在支付环节启用动态加密参数,提升交易安全性。相比第三方平台提供的“黑盒”服务,源码级开发让企业的数据主权真正掌握在自己手中,也为合规审计和风控体系建设打下坚实基础。
长远来看,以源码为核心驱动的小程序软件开发模式,正在推动整个生态向更自主、更安全的方向演进。它不仅是技术选择,更是一种战略思维的转变——从“拿来主义”走向“自主可控”。尤其在当前政策鼓励国产化替代、数据安全日益受重视的大背景下,具备源码能力的企业将拥有更强的抗风险能力和市场话语权。
我们专注于为中小企业提供定制化的小程序软件开发服务,擅长基于真实业务场景进行深度源码级优化,帮助客户实现性能跃升与用户体验升级。团队具备丰富的深圳本地项目经验,熟悉从需求分析到上线运维的全链路流程,能够高效交付符合行业标准的高质量产品。如果您正在寻找一支能真正理解您业务逻辑、愿意与您共同打磨产品的技术伙伴,欢迎随时联系:18140119082


